The cheapest way to get from Bodmin to Powderham Castle is to bus which costs £12 - £27 and takes 3h 58m.
The fastest way to get from Bodmin to Powderham Castle is to drive which takes 1h 13m and costs £16 - £25.
No, there is no direct bus from Bodmin to Powderham Castle. However, there are services departing from Dennison Road Car Park and arriving at Castle Gates via Bus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 58m.
The distance between Bodmin and Powderham Castle is 76 miles. The road distance is 68.7 miles.
The best way to get from Bodmin to Powderham Castle without a car is to bus and train which takes 3h 32m and costs £40 - £95.
It takes approximately 3h 32m to get from Bodmin to Powderham Castle, including transfers.
Bodmin to Powderham Castle bus services, operated by National Express, depart from Dennison Road Car Park station.
Bodmin to Powderham Castle bus services, operated by National Express, arrive at Bampfylde Street station.
Yes, the driving distance between Bodmin to Powderham Castle is 69 miles. It takes approximately 1h 13m to drive from Bodmin to Powderham Castle.
